# Blazor
## Trigger On
- building interactive web UIs with C# instead of JavaScript - choosing between Server, WebAssembly, or Auto render modes - designing component hierarchies and state management - handling prerendering and hydration - integrating with JavaScript when necessary
## Documentation
- [Blazor Overview](https://learn.microsoft.com/en-us/aspnet/core/blazor/?view=aspnetcore-10.0) - [Render Modes](https://learn.microsoft.com/en-us/aspnet/core/blazor/components/render-modes?view=aspnetcore-10.0) - [Performance Best Practices](https://learn.microsoft.com/en-us/aspnet/core/blazor/performance?view=aspnetcore-10.0) - [State Management](https://learn.microsoft.com/en-us/aspnet/core/blazor/state-management?view=aspnetcore-10.0) - [JS Interop](https://learn.microsoft.com/en-us/aspnet/core/blazor/javascript-interoperability/?view=aspnetcore-10.0)
### References
- [patterns.md](references/patterns.md) - Detailed component patterns, state management strategies, and JS interop techniques - [anti-patterns.md](references/anti-patterns.md) - Common Blazor mistakes and how to avoid them
## Render Modes (.NET 8+)
| Mode | Where It Runs | Best For | |------|---------------|----------| | `Static` | Server (no interactivity) | SEO pages, marketing content | | `InteractiveServer` | Server via SignalR | Real-time apps, thin clients | | `InteractiveWebAssembly` | Browser via WASM | Offline-capable, client-heavy | | `InteractiveAuto` | Server first, then WASM | Best of both worlds |
### Applying Render Modes
```razor @* Per-component *@ @rendermode InteractiveServer
@* Or in App.razor for global *@ <Routes @rendermode="InteractiveAuto" /> ```
### InteractiveAuto Architecture
``` First Request: Browser → Server (Interactive Server) → Fast response
Subsequent Requests: Browser → WASM (downloaded in background) → No server needed ```
## Workflow
1. **Choose render mode based on requirements:** - Need SEO? Start with Static or prerendering - Need real-time? Use InteractiveServer - Need offline? Use InteractiveWebAssembly - Want both? Use InteractiveAuto
2. **Design components for reusability:** - Small, focused components - Parameters for customization - Events for communication
3. **Handle state correctly:** - Component state lives in component - Shared state via services (DI) - Persist state across prerender with `[PersistentState]`
4. **Validate in both environments** (for Auto mode)

## Component Patterns
### Basic Component ```razor @* Counter.razor *@ <button @onclick="IncrementCount"> Clicked @count times </button>
@code { private int count = 0;
[Parameter] public int InitialCount { get; set; } = 0;
protected override void OnInitialized() { count = InitialCount; }
private void IncrementCount() => count++; } ```
### Parameter and Event Callbacks ```razor @* Parent.razor *@ <ChildComponent Value="@value" ValueChanged="@OnValueChanged" />
@* ChildComponent.razor *@ @code { [Parameter] public string Value { get; set; } = ""; [Parameter] public EventCallback<string> ValueChanged { get; set; }
private async Task UpdateValue(string newValue) { await ValueChanged.InvokeAsync(newValue); } } ```
### State Persistence (.NET 8+) ```razor @* Prevents double-fetch during prerender + hydration *@ @code { [PersistentState] public List<Product> Products { get; set; } = [];
protected override async Task OnInitializedAsync() { // Only fetches once, persisted across prerender Products ??= await Http.GetFromJsonAsync<List<Product>>("api/products"); } } ```
## Data Access Pattern for Auto Mode
```csharp // Shared interface public interface IProductService { Task<List<Product>> GetProductsAsync(); }
// Server implementation (direct DB access) public class ServerProductService : IProductService { private readonly AppDbContext _db; public async Task<List<Product>> GetProductsAsync() => await _db.Products.ToListAsync(); }
// Client implementation (HTTP call) public class ClientProductService : IProductService { private readonly HttpClient _http; public async Task<List<Product>> GetProductsAsync() => await _http.GetFromJsonAsync<List<Product>>("api/products"); }
// Registration // Server: builder.Services.AddScoped<IProductService, ServerProductService>(); // Client: builder.Services.AddScoped<IProductService, ClientProductService>(); ```
## Anti-Patterns to Avoid
| Anti-Pattern | Why It's Bad | Better Approach | |--------------|--------------|-----------------| | Large components | Hard to maintain, slow renders | Split into smaller components | | Direct DB access in WASM | No DB in browser | Use HTTP API | | Ignoring `ShouldRender` | Unnecessary re-renders | Override when needed | | Sync JS interop in Server | Blocks SignalR circuit | Use `IJSRuntime` async | | No error boundaries | One error crashes app | Use `<ErrorBoundary>` | | Forgetting prerender state | Double API calls | Use `[PersistentState]` |
## Performance Best Practices
1. **Virtualize large lists:** ```razor <Virtualize Items="@products" Context="product"> <ProductCard Product="@product" /> </Virtualize> ```
2. **Use `@key` for list diffing:** ```razor @foreach (var item in items) { <ItemComponent @key="item.Id" Item="@item" /> } ```
3. **Debounce rapid events:** ```csharp private Timer? _debounceTimer;
private void OnInput(ChangeEventArgs e) { _debounceTimer?.Dispose(); _debounceTimer = new Timer(_ => InvokeAsync(DoSearch), null, 300, Timeout.Infinite); } ```
4. **Lazy load assemblies (WASM):** ```csharp var assemblies = await LazyAssemblyLoader .LoadAssembliesAsync(["MyHeavyFeature.wasm"]); ```
## JS Interop
### Calling JavaScript from C# ```csharp @inject IJSRuntime JS
await JS.InvokeVoidAsync("alert", "Hello from Blazor!"); var result = await JS.InvokeAsync<string>("prompt", "Enter name:"); ```
### Calling C# from JavaScript ```csharp [JSInvokable] public static string GetMessage() => "Hello from C#!"; ```
```javascript DotNet.invokeMethodAsync('MyAssembly', 'GetMessage') .then(result => console.log(result)); ```
## Deliver
- interactive Blazor components with appropriate render mode - efficient state management and data flow - proper handling of prerendering scenarios - performant list rendering with virtualization
## Validate
- components render correctly in chosen mode - state persists correctly across prerender/hydration - no unnecessary re-renders (check with browser tools) - JS interop works in both Server and WASM - error boundaries catch component failures - Auto mode works in both environments
